You can change parts of the game to resemble chemical warfare, but I'm not sure it would be a huge change.

Basically, instead of launching nukes you are launching missiles that disperse chemical agents. A few language modifications, redoing the nuke explosion.bmp to resemble some kind of gas-cloud and you're away. However, I'm not sure how satisfying this would be for you.

Modding defcon is graphical only and you cannot mod the physics of the game. There aren't any (as far as I am aware) games that feature chemical or biological warfare as a fundamental gameplay aspect. Simply people don't even want to think about the consequences of such actions.

I've just been reading HG Wells' 'The Shape of Things to Come' - a book written not long before the 2nd world war that attempted to predict the next couple of hundred years of history. He saw the war coming but massively under-estimated the Nazis (in his version WW2 begins with the Poles invading Germany). Although he doesn't see nukes coming, he expects chemical weapons to advance to a level that approaches them for nastiness and devastation. He lists a few different gasses that kill people in various unpleasant ways but the worst is his 'permanent death gas' - actually a fine dust dropped from planes that kills everything in the area attacked and persists for decades. It gets thrown around pretty widely as armies try to deny each other whole cities and hundreds of miles countryside.
